Still about Myanmar's possible chairmanship of ASEAN
Another bit of news suggesting that Myanmar will decline chairmanship of ASEAN, from ST (May 4; subscription required):
Military-ruled Myanmar, under pressure from the United States and other Western nations for its repression of democracy, may back away from the chairmanship of the Association of Southeast Asian Nations, a senior Thai official said on Wednesday.But like I said before, even if it happens, it may not mean much for the future of the country. In the meantime, The Aseanist sticks by its earlier prediction.
